结论:EulerOS和CentOS在某些方面有相似之处,但它们是两个不同的操作系统,有着各自的特性和应用场景。
EulerOS是华为自主研发的操作系统,而CentOS是基于Red Hat Enterprise Linux(RHEL)的社区支持版本。
EulerOS和CentOS都属于Linux家族,因此它们在内核、文件系统、命令行工具等方面有很多共通点。然而,两者的开发背景、目标用户群体以及技术支持模式存在显著差异。
首先,从开发背景来看,EulerOS由华为公司主导开发,旨在满足其自身及合作伙伴在服务器、云计算、边缘计算等领域的多样化需求。EulerOS不仅支持x86架构,还特别优化了对鲲鹏处理器的支持,以适应国产化硬件环境。相比之下,CentOS是由社区驱动的项目,基于RHEL源代码构建,主要目的是为用户提供一个免费且稳定的替代方案。CentOS的目标是保持与RHEL的高度兼容性,以便用户能够在无需购买商业许可证的情况下,享受到类似的企业级功能和服务。
其次,目标用户群体也有所不同。EulerOS主要面向企业级用户,特别是那些对安全性和稳定性有较高要求的行业,如X_X、电信、能源等。它提供了丰富的安全特性,如多级安全机制、加密通信协议等,并且通过了多项国内外权威认证。此外,EulerOS还集成了华为云服务,便于用户进行云端部署和管理。而CentOS则更广泛地适用于各类开发者和技术爱好者,无论是个人项目还是中小企业都可以使用。由于其开源性质,CentOS拥有庞大的用户基础和活跃的社区支持,用户可以通过论坛、邮件列表等方式获取帮助和建议。
最后,在技术支持模式上,EulerOS提供官方的技术支持渠道,包括在线文档、客服热线、远程协助等。对于关键业务场景,还可以签订SLA(服务水平协议),确保问题得到及时响应和解决。与此同时,EulerOS还定期发布更新补丁,修复已知漏洞并优化性能。相反,CentOS依赖于社区的力量来进行维护和支持。虽然也有官方团队负责核心部分的工作,但对于普通用户来说,遇到复杂问题时可能需要花费更多时间去寻找解决方案。
综上所述,尽管EulerOS和CentOS都是优秀的Linux发行版,但在实际应用中应根据具体需求选择合适的产品。如果您的业务涉及国产化硬件或需要高度定制化的解决方案,那么EulerOS可能是更好的选择;若您追求稳定可靠且成本较低的企业级平台,同时希望借助强大的社区资源,则可以考虑使用CentOS。
云知识